在当今的云计算环境中,对象存储服务(Object Storage Service, OSS)扮演着至关重要的角色,特别是在数据存储和管理方面,获取桶日志管理配置是对象存储中一个重要的功能,它允许用户或管理员查看和管理存储桶(bucket)的日志设置,确保数据访问和操作的透明度与可追溯性,下面将深入探讨如何获取桶日志管理配置,包括必要的步骤、所需权限和实际应用示例:
1、必要条件和权限要求
拥有者或授权用户:只有桶的所有者或被授权的用户才能获取桶日志管理配置,这确保了配置信息的安全性,防止未经授权的访问。
IAM和桶策略授权:建议通过IAM(Identity and Access Management)或桶策略来进行授权,如果是使用IAM,需要授予obs:bucket:GetBucketLogging
权限,这为管理员提供了灵活的授权选项,以满足不同的安全要求。
2、配置获取流程
使用HTTP的GET方法:通过HTTP的GET方法和添加logging
子资源来实现查询当前桶的日志配置,这种方法简单直接,兼容于多数网络请求方式。
具体步骤:用户首需确定自己拥有访问权限,然后通过支持HTTP请求的工具或库,发送带有适当头部和参数的GET请求到服务器,服务器响应后,用户可以查看或处理返回的日志配置信息。
3、编程接口的使用
ObsClient.GetBucketLogging方法:用户可以通过编程语言调用此方法来查看桶的日志配置,使用Python的SDK,可以通过简单的函数调用实现这一点,极大简化了操作过程。
示例代码:示例代码通常包括初始化客户端、设置请求参数、发送请求和处理响应等步骤,这些步骤确保了从请求到获取再到处理配置的整个过程的自动化和错误最小化。
4、日志管理配置的重要性
审计和合规性:日志记录了每一次对桶的操作,对于满足法规要求、进行安全审计和排查问题是极其重要的。
优化和问题定位:分析日志可以帮助管理员识别存储系统的使用模式,优化资源配置,以及快速定位和解决系统故障。
5、安全性考虑
权限控制:严格的权限校验确保只有授权用户才能访问日志配置,减少了数据泄露的风险。
数据保护:日志中可能含有敏感操作信息,因此加密传输和存储日志数据是保护数据不被非法访问的重要措施。
在实际操作中,还需注意以下因素:
确认请求的URL和参数的正确性。
检查网络连接的稳定性,以防请求失败。
定期更新安全凭证和审核授权策略,以维护安全态势。
获取桶日志管理配置是对象存储管理中一个关键的功能,它不仅帮助管理员监控和审计桶内的数据操作,还能及时发现和解决问题,通过正确的授权、使用合适的工具和方法,任何有权用户都可以有效地管理和利用这些日志信息,以增强存储系统的安全性和可靠性。
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/879857.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复